Sat 1327728133937350

decimal
321091.633937350
degree
0°111091′547″633937350‴
percentile
63.2251493046596%
name
elfcqbqwxbn
cycle
0
epoch
1
period
159
block
321091
offset
633937350
timestamp
rarity
common
inscriptions
location
6b81c38fdc01ba9941fe0e205e7ce44858f3702b8cd4abff32c64e54c55eb85b:1:135688584
address
bc1qeqwfhrvf0rduqh67wwzpmjzauts3retfceatcq